Lenders more cautious over 0% balance transfers
Lenders are becoming increasingly cautious over taking on customers for zero per cent balance transfers, a price comparison site has claimed.
According to Samantha Owens, head of personal finance at Moneyfacts.co.uk, ostensibly customers have more choice over zero per cent balance transfers than ever, with the time period over which the zero per cent rate is offered in many cases having been extended.
However, attempting to secure these deals has become harder recently as a result of credit card providers tightening their lending criteria, she said.
"Whilst this increase in the length of balance transfer offer appears good news for financially stretched consumers, the reality is somewhat different than a few years ago.
"The downside is that balance transfer fees have increased with many being uncapped, lenders have tightened up their credit scoring criteria, so you need an almost spotless credit history to get your hands on one of these deals," she said.
Lenders are also charging higher charges for balance transfers, many of which are uncapped, Ms Owens added.
